    Roller Block Cams?

    Hold on, the '81 isn't a roller block. A '91 is. They didn't phase in the roller cams until '86 on the 318, and '88 on a 360. Dropping the roller cam lifter dog bones and spider hardware in a non-roller block doesn't work. The block we used in my buddy's Challenger was an early '90's 360...

    No Electronic box in pointless distributor

    The later Lean Burn system (re-branded "Electronic Spark Control") in the '80's used the single pickup design and no advance mechanism. I agree there's a box or module hidden somewhere on the car, probably under the dash.
